Starting point is 00:52:57 I was just using up my best brainpower time on things that truly don't move the needle at all. The vast majority of business owners work a fair amount. They just work on the wrong stuff and they do it. wrong way. And so they get so little for their effort that they wonder when they're at home, empty-handed, in bed, why is in this working when I am working? But if you define work, at least the way I do, which is output. And in order to get output, it's volume times leverage. So how many times you do the thing times how much you get for each time you do it. And so that is the do you work smart or do you work hard. It's you do both. You do as many reps as you possibly can. And you do it with
Starting point is 00:53:38 the most leveraged possible. So if I make 100 phone calls, the leverage that I can have there would be how skilled I am. So if I make 100 calls, I might get 10 times more. And so I worked more. I had more output that somebody has less skill. But the only way you get skilled is by working more. And so it's this virtuous cycle of doing more and getting better, and then you get more for what you do. But you look at somebody like Steph Curry, and you see this guy, you know, shoot the ball from almost half court. He doesn't even look. He turns around and just waves because he knows it's in already. And there's swish and the crowd goes crazy. And people look at it and go, he's unbelievable. He is.
Starting point is 01:23:43 unbelievable. It's unbelievable. He's the greatest three-point shooter in history. There's no one like him. But what they don't pay attention to is that isn't like a little gift. He shoots 500 shots every single day, never less than that, seven days a week for more than 15 years. The 15-year professional career. He's been doing it since before he was in college. His dad really trained him. So think of that, 3,500 shots a week, 168,000 shots in a year, 2 million shots in his 15-year NBA career, so he could make 3,600 shots. not even one-tenth of one percent. I tell people you get rewarded in public for what you practice in private.
